Output 7ef6ea8625056ff7cbeeef5f3b37639262607b102b242d5e7741cf7d0ec1de59:0

value
16394791
script pubkey
OP_0 OP_PUSHBYTES_20 ef74fc3bf1fcf046f15ce19b04147e32554cdc46
address
bc1qaa60cwl3lncydu2uuxdsg9r7xf25ehzxmkera7
transaction
7ef6ea8625056ff7cbeeef5f3b37639262607b102b242d5e7741cf7d0ec1de59
confirmations
181269
spent
true